CentOS安装SSH的完整指南
在CentOS系统上安装SSH是提高服务器安全性和便利性的重要步骤。本文将指导您完成整个安装过程。
检查SSH是否已安装
打开终端,输入命令:ssh -V
。如果显示SSH版本信息,说明已安装;否则,继续下一步。
安装OpenSSH
使用以下命令安装OpenSSH服务器和客户端:
sudo yum install openssh-server openssh-clients
启动SSH服务
安装完成后,启动SSH服务并设置开机自启:
sudo systemctl start sshd
sudo systemctl enable sshd
配置防火墙
确保防火墙允许SSH连接:
sudo firewall-cmd --permanent --add-service=ssh
sudo firewall-cmd --reload
修改SSH配置(可选)
编辑SSH配置文件以增强安全性:
sudo nano /etc/ssh/sshd_config
可以修改端口、禁用root登录等。修改后重启SSH服务:
sudo systemctl restart sshd
测试SSH连接
在另一台机器上使用SSH客户端连接到CentOS服务器:
ssh username@your_server_ip
结语
通过以上步骤,您已成功在CentOS上安装并配置了SSH。这将大大提高您管理服务器的效率和安全性。记得定期更新系统和SSH,以保持最佳安全状态。